uLib  User mode C/C++ extended API library for Win32 programmers.
Parameter Annotation

Module Description

Argument annotations.
Unlike 'sal.h' these are only semantic sugar.

Macros

#define _in
 
#define _out
 
#define _inout
 
#define _opt
 
#define _optin
 
#define _optout
 
#define _optio
 
#define INOUT
 
#define OPTIN
 
#define OPTOUT
 
#define OPTIO
 

Macro Definition Documentation

◆ _in

#define _in

Input

Definition at line 253 of file Common.h.

◆ _out

#define _out

Output

Definition at line 254 of file Common.h.

◆ _inout

#define _inout

In- and output

Definition at line 255 of file Common.h.

◆ _opt

#define _opt

Optional

Definition at line 256 of file Common.h.

◆ _optin

#define _optin

Optional input

Definition at line 257 of file Common.h.

◆ _optout

#define _optout

Optional output

Definition at line 258 of file Common.h.

◆ _optio

#define _optio

Optional in- and output

Definition at line 259 of file Common.h.

◆ INOUT

#define INOUT

In- and output

Definition at line 262 of file Common.h.

◆ OPTIN

#define OPTIN

Optional input

Definition at line 263 of file Common.h.

◆ OPTOUT

#define OPTOUT

Optional output

Definition at line 264 of file Common.h.

◆ OPTIO

#define OPTIO

Optional in- and output

Definition at line 265 of file Common.h.